elective abortion
e·lec·tive a·bor·tion
Definitions related to elective abortion:
-
(induced abortion) A surgical or medical procedure that ends a pregnancy by causing the removal or expulsion of the products of conception.NICHD Pediatric TerminologyU.S. National Cancer Institute, 2021
-
(induced abortion procedure) A surgical or medical procedure that terminates a pregnancy by removing the products of conception.NCI ThesaurusU.S. National Cancer Institute, 2021
-
Elective termination of pregnancy remains common in the United States and worldwide, and controversy and debate are ongoing. Accurate statistics have been kept since the enactment of the 1973 US Supreme Court decisions legalizing abortions.WebMD, 2019
